(sysbuild)= # Sysbuild (System build) Sysbuild is a higher-level build system that can be used to combine multiple other build systems together. For more details please follow the [Zephyr Sysbuild (System build)](https://docs.zephyrproject.org/latest/build/sysbuild/index.html) documentation. >**Note:** Sysbuild is a notion that originates from Zephyr. However, it is currently also used by the west-based MCUXpresso SDK (SDK version 24.12 or newer), which relies on the same west/CMake build infrastructure. As a result, the Sysbuild enablement and behavior described here apply both to Zephyr projects and to west-based MCUXpresso SDK projects. ## Enable or disable Sysbuild To enable or disable Sysbuild, go to the context menu of the project, select "Set Sysbuild" under the "Configure" group and select the desired option. ![Set Sysbuild command](./pictures/nxp-zephyr-set-sysbuild.png) ![Set Sysbuild options](./pictures/nxp-zephyr-set-sysbuild-options.png) ## Controlling Sysbuild from the Tasks Automation Framework Sysbuild enablement can also be controlled programmatically through the {doc}`Tasks Automation Framework `. The `"buildProject"`, `"cleanProject"`, and `"rebuildProject"` task commands each expose an optional `sysbuild` boolean property inside their `commandOptions`. When the `sysbuild` property is set, it overrides the enablement state for that task execution. By default, the enablement state is the one specified in the example/project definition at import/creation time. For example, to disable Sysbuild when building a project: ```json { "type": "MCUXpresso", "version": "1.0.0", "label": "Build without Sysbuild", "commandOptions": { "command": "buildProject", "projectName": "my_project", "buildConfigName": "debug", "sysbuild": false } } ``` The same `sysbuild` property is available for the `"cleanProject"` and `"rebuildProject"` commands. Refer to the {doc}`Tasks Definition ` documentation for the full list of properties supported by each command. ## Known issues and workarounds - For some boards (e.g. EVK-MIMXRT595 and MIMXRT700-EVK), certain example projects (such as the DSP and eIQ examples) can only be built when the Xtensa development toolchain is available. As a result, these projects cannot be built with Sysbuild enabled in environments that provide only the Arm toolchain. *Workaround:* Disable Sysbuild for the affected project before building, either from the UI ("Set Sysbuild" under the "Configure" contextual menu) or by setting the `sysbuild` property to `false` in the `"buildProject"`, `"cleanProject"`, or `"rebuildProject"` task definition.
